Only five minutes from Pemberton - this unique timber home, set on five acres and nestled within majestic Karri trees, is a tranquil private hideaway.. .Once known as the Artist's Barn Studio, this iconic property, surrounded by beautiful gardens, fruit trees and water features, is situated in a peaceful location on the edge of the Arboretum forest. Visited daily by a family of kangaroos, you are minutes away from the vibrant timber town set amidst rolling hills and forests of giant trees.

Like most areas in Australia, we need to be mindful of water use. The water for house use is sourced from a rainwater tank and for this reason, we thank you to be careful to have short showers of a suggested length of two minutes. This will ensure there is enough water for you and your guests during your stay and also for future guests.
Likewise, we must ensure our beautiful garden is water-wise. This means that in the cooler and kinder months, our plants thrive with great beauty. However, in Summer (with heatwaves and water restrictions) our garden is challenged by dry earth and sunny skies. Please be aware that although we do our best, like most gardens in our area of Australia, our garden is waiting for the cooler months to renew and thrive!
Please be mindful of the fire restrictions from December 1 - March 31 inclusive and be aware of any current fire bans in the area before lighting any fires outside or in the wood heater inside.
